Bill Summary
AN ACT to amend the public housing law, in relation to requiring the New York city housing authority to have a searchable database of ticket numbers
AI Summary
This bill requires the New York City Housing Authority (NYCHA) to have a searchable database of ticket numbers for complaints filed by residents, either by phone or online. The database must provide detailed information about each complaint, including the explanation, current status, whether it is open or closed, any actions taken, and next steps. The database must exclude personal information like apartment numbers and resident names. The bill will take effect on January 1st of the year following its enactment, with necessary rules and regulations authorized to be implemented by the effective date.
